Duration: 5 and 1/2 years (including 1 year of compulsory internship). Eligibility: Students must have passed the 10 + 2 standard with science (PCB) or any other examination recognized as equivalent to the same and with English as one of the languages. You must have achieved a minimum of 50 percent marks in the aggregate of the relevant science subject (PCB) in the 12th standard examination. Admission process: Students are admitted to the BAMS course on the merit basis obtained in the NEET conducted by NTA. Candidates shall apply/enroll on the AYUSH Admissions Central Counseling Committee website. The college cut-off is decided by the selection board. The merit list is based on the results of NEET. If you belong to the SC/ST/OBC category, then you have to score a 40 percentile in the NEET exam. If you belong to the UR category, then you have to score 50 percentile in the NEET exam.     Placements: As B.A.M.S. is a medical course, there are no placements through the college. After completing your 4.5 years of B.A.M.S. curriculum, you have to complete one year of mandatory internship, during which you will get a paid fixed stipend of 18,000 rupees per month. After that, several options will open for you, such as opening your own OPD center or going for PG, where you can be paid around seventy to eighty thousand rupees per month. Apart from this, B.A.M.S. students can also go for research or business.

The B.A.M.S. curriculum is divided into 3 proffs and one year of internship. In each proff, there will be 3 terms, and each term has four exams: three periodicals and one term-end examination. The semester exams are not much difficult to pass. You have to score at least 50 percent marks to pass the exam.
